The Role
As an SEN Teacher you will take a lead role in planning delivering and assessing lessons for pupils with additional needs. You will support pupils learning in line with Individual Education Plans (IEPs) and EHCP targets provide personalised interventions and work closely with teaching assistants colleagues and parents to ensure continuity of support. You will also monitor pupil progress and adapt teaching strategies to meet individual learning needs.
You will be responsible for promoting positive behaviour independence and resilience ensuring pupils feel confident included and motivated to learn.
Key Responsibilities
Plan deliver and assess high-quality lessons for pupils with SEND
Implement and monitor IEPs and EHCP targets
Deliver targeted interventions to support pupils academic and personal development
Promote positive behaviour independence and resilience
Track pupil progress and maintain accurate assessment records
Collaborate closely with teaching assistants colleagues and senior leaders
Communicate effectively with parents and carers regarding pupil progress
Contribute to staff meetings CPD sessions and whole-school initiatives
Support transitions enrichment activities and school events
Ensure safeguarding and child protection procedures are strictly followed
